Responsibilities
- Interpret and analyze medical images including X-rays, CT scans, MRIs, and ultrasounds.
- Communicate findings and recommendations to referring physicians and other healthcare professionals.
- Collaborate with other radiologists and medical staff to provide accurate and timely diagnoses.
- Utilize advanced imaging techniques to assist in the diagnosis and treatment of complex cases.
- Maintain accurate and detailed records of all procedures and patient information.
- Stay up-to-date with the latest advancements and developments in the field of diagnostic radiology. Requirements:
- Board Certification from the American Board of Radiology.
- Current license to practice medicine in any State, Territory, or Commonwealth of the United States or the District of Columbia.
- Active BLS and ACLS certifications.
- DEA registration.
- Minimum of 2 years of experience in diagnostic radiology.
- Proficiency in advanced imaging techniques such as MRI, CT, and ultrasound.
- Excellent communication and interpersonal skills.
- Ability to thrive in a fast-paced and dynamic environment.
